In today’s digital landscape, browser extensions have become an integral part of our online experience, enhancing productivity, customizing our web interactions, and providing tools that simplify our daily tasks. However, as we embrace these convenient add-ons, it’s essential to navigate the potential risks they pose to our privacy and security. The browser extension threat model is a crucial framework that helps us identify the vulnerabilities inherent in these tools, as well as the strategies we can implement to safeguard ourselves.
In this article, we will unpack the intricacies of the browser extension threat model, exploring the various risks associated with extensions, and offering practical safeguards to help you enjoy a safer browsing experience. Whether you are a casual internet user or a tech-savvy professional, understanding these factors will empower you to make informed decisions about the extensions you choose to install. Let’s dive in and enhance our digital safety together!
Understanding the Unique Risks Posed by Browser Extensions
Browser extensions can dramatically enhance our browsing experience by adding functionalities and improving efficiency. However, they also introduce a range of unique risks that users often overlook. A key concern is the potential for data leakage; many extensions request extensive permissions which may allow them to access sensitive information, such as passwords, credit card details, and personal browsing habits. This level of access, combined with the fact that extensions can operate in the background, raises alarming questions about the integrity of user data and privacy.
Another risk is the possibility of malicious extensions masquerading as helpful tools. These can serve as gateways for malware, adware, or even phishing attacks. Users may unwittingly install such extensions, believing them to be reputable, only to find their systems compromised. To better understand these risks, consider the table below which outlines common permissions requested by extensions and their associated threats.
Requested Permission | Associated Threats |
---|---|
Read and change all your data on the websites you visit | Data leakage, session hijacking |
Access your browser history | Privacy invasion, targeted phishing |
Communicate with cooperating websites | Data collection, cross-site tracking |
Access to your clipboard | Clipboard hijacking, sensitive data exposure |
By recognizing these risks and understanding the implications behind permissions, users can navigate the world of browser extensions more safely and make informed choices about which tools to trust.
Identifying Common Vulnerabilities in Popular Extensions
When it comes to browser extensions, certain vulnerabilities are more prevalent than others, making it essential for users to be aware of the risks they pose. One of the most common issues is improper permissions management. Extensions often request access to multiple sites or resources that are unnecessary for their functionality. This overreach can lead to sensitive data exposure, allowing malicious actors to exploit these permissions for data harvesting or unauthorized actions. Regularly auditing the permissions of installed extensions can significantly mitigate this risk and ensure that users are only granting access to what is absolutely necessary.
Another frequently encountered vulnerability is insufficient code reviews and quality assurance practices among developers. Many popular extensions are open-source, attracting contributions from a wide range of developers, not all of whom may adhere to secure coding standards. This lack of oversight can introduce critical security flaws, from cross-site scripting (XSS) vulnerabilities to data leakage bugs. Users should favor extensions with a strong reputation for security updates and active maintenance. Below is a simple comparison table of some popular extensions and their known vulnerabilities:
Extension | Known Vulnerabilities | Last Security Update |
---|---|---|
AdBlock Plus | Potential data tracking | August 2023 |
LastPass | Data breach incidents | September 2023 |
Honey | Overreaching permissions | July 2023 |
By keeping an eye on the security practices surrounding these extensions, users can better protect themselves against potential threats and foster a safer browsing experience. Understanding these common vulnerabilities is a critical step in navigating the complex landscape of browser extensions, empowering users with the knowledge they need to make informed decisions.
Best Practices for Securing Your Browser Environment
To create a secure browser environment, it is essential to manage your browser extensions wisely. Start by only installing extensions from reputable sources, such as official app stores or verified developers. Always double-check user reviews and the number of downloads, as these metrics can provide insight into an extension’s reliability. Regularly audit your installed extensions, removing any that you no longer use or recognize. This practice minimizes vulnerabilities and reduces the risk of malicious extensions compromising your data.
Another critical aspect of safeguarding your browsing experience is to leverage built-in browser security settings. Enabling features such as “Do Not Track” requests, pop-up blockers, and phishing filters can significantly bolster your online security. Additionally, consider using privacy-focused extensions that enhance your browser’s defenses against tracking and ads. Below is a table summarizing key browser settings and their benefits:
Browser Setting | Benefit |
---|---|
Do Not Track | Prevents websites from tracking your browsing behavior. |
Pop-up Blocker | Blocks intrusive ads and potential malicious pop-ups. |
Phishing Filters | Alerts you before visiting known malicious sites. |
Enhanced Privacy Mode | Reduces tracking and clears data after each session. |
Choosing the Right Extensions: Evaluating Trust and Safety
When selecting browser extensions, one of the first steps is to assess the trustworthiness of the developer. A well-established developer with a history of producing reliable software is generally a safer choice. You should also consider the reviews and ratings from other users, as well as any media coverage regarding the extension. If a developer is secretive about their identity or provides vague information about the extension’s purpose, it may be a red flag. Look for transparency in terms of permissions requested; extensions that ask for excessive permissions irrelevant to their primary function should be approached with caution.
Another critical factor in evaluating extensions is how they handle user data. Many extensions operate with access to sensitive information, so it’s crucial to know what data they collect and how they use it. Extensions from reputable developers often have clear privacy policies that detail data handling practices. Users should be wary of extensions that do not provide this information. To assist in decision-making, consider the following table that outlines key questions to evaluate before adding an extension:
Question | Importance |
---|---|
Who is the developer? | High |
What do user reviews say? | Medium |
What permissions are required? | High |
Is there a clear privacy policy? | High |
Is the source code open for review? | Medium |
By considering these factors, users can make more informed choices that enhance their browsing experience while minimizing risks associated with unsafe extensions.
Q&A
Q1: What exactly is a browser extension, and why do we use them?
A1: A browser extension is a small software program that modifies or enhances the functionality of a web browser. Users install these extensions to improve their web experience—be it through ad-blocking, password management, or productivity tools. Essentially, they help tailor the browsing experience to individual needs.
Q2: What are the common risks associated with browser extensions?
A2: While browser extensions are incredibly useful, they come with risks. Some common threats include:
- Malware: Some extensions may contain malicious code that can steal personal data or hijack browser settings.
- Privacy Invasion: Extensions might track your online activities and collect sensitive information without your consent.
- Unintended Data Sharing: Extensions can potentially expose your data to third-party services, leading to unauthorized access.
Q3: How can users identify a potentially harmful extension?
A3: Users should look out for several red flags:
- Limited Reviews: Extensions with few or no reviews may not be trustworthy.
- Request for Unnecessary Permissions: If an extension requests permissions that are not relevant to its function, it’s best to steer clear.
- Unfamiliar Developers: Researching the developer’s reputation can provide insights into the extension’s reliability.
- Frequent Updates: Extensions that are regularly maintained and updated are generally more secure.
Q4: What safeguards can users implement to minimize risks?
A4: Here are some effective safeguards:
- Install Only Trusted Extensions: Stick to extensions from reputable developers and official browser stores.
- Read Permissions Carefully: Before installing, review the permissions the extension requests and ensure they are relevant.
- Keep Extensions Updated: Regularly check for updates and remove extensions you no longer use.
- Use Privacy Extensions: Some tools are designed to enhance privacy and block tracking, adding an additional layer of protection.
Q5: How do browser developers help in securing extensions?
A5: Browser developers, like Google and Mozilla, implement several measures:
- Review Process: Before extensions are listed, they often go through a rigorous review process to identify malicious behavior.
- User Feedback Mechanisms: Users can report suspicious extensions, prompting developers to investigate further.
- Regular Security Audits: Developers perform audits and updates to patch vulnerabilities and improve security.
Q6: What can browser extension developers do to enhance security?
A6: Developers can take proactive steps, such as:
- Transparent Privacy Policies: Clearly outline data collection practices to build trust with users.
- Minimal Permissions: Only request permissions that are absolutely necessary for the extension’s functionality.
- Regular Updates: Maintain the extension with regular updates to fix bugs and security vulnerabilities.
Q7: what is the key takeaway regarding browser extension security?
A7: The key takeaway is that while browser extensions offer valuable enhancements to our web experience, they also come with inherent risks. By being informed and proactive—such as verifying the trustworthiness of extensions, understanding their permissions, and using security practices—users can enjoy the benefits of extensions while minimizing potential threats. Safe browsing is all about making informed choices!
—
Feel free to reach out if you have more questions or need further information!
In Summary
navigating the intricate landscape of browser extensions requires a keen understanding of the various risks they pose, alongside the protective measures that can enhance your online security. By unpacking the browser extension threat model, we’ve shed light on potential vulnerabilities and the importance of being proactive in safeguarding your digital experience.
As you explore the wide array of extensions available, remember to carefully evaluate permissions, seek out reputable sources, and keep your software updated. Awareness is your best defense. By making informed choices and adopting good security practices, you can enjoy the convenience and functionality that browser extensions offer while minimizing potential threats to your privacy and data.
Stay curious, stay cautious, and happy browsing! If you have any further questions or insights about browser extensions or online safety, feel free to share your thoughts in the comments below. Your experiences and tips could help others navigate the digital world more safely.